Progyny is seeking a Graduate Student Intern to support the Talent Acquisition (TA) team in building a comprehensive, data-driven analytics foundation. This role will focus on designing and developing a centralized TA metrics dashboard and generating actionable insights to improve hiring outcomes, increase efficiency, and enable faster, higher-quality hiring decisions. 

This is a high-impact, project-based internship ideal for a candidate interested in applying analytics and AI to real-world Talent Acquisition challenges. 

What you will do...

TA Dashboard Development 

  • Partner with the Director of Talent Acquisition and Talent Intelligence Associate to design and build a centralized TA dashboard 
  • Assess current data sources (e.g., ATS, spreadsheets) and identify gaps 
  • Define key metrics and KPIs aligned to TA and business goals 
  • Build dashboards tracking pipeline health, time-to-fill, time-in-stage, conversion rates, source effectiveness, diversity metrics, and recruiter productivity 
  • Ensure data accuracy, consistency, and integrity 
  • Iterate on dashboard design based on stakeholder feedback 

Data Analysis & Insights 

  • Conduct funnel analysis to identify bottlenecks in the hiring process 
  • Analyze recruiter productivity and capacity 
  • Identify trends and patterns to improve hiring outcomes 
  • Translate data into clear, actionable insights and recommendations 

AI & Advanced Analytics 

  • Leverage AI tools and techniques to enhance data analysis and insight generation 
  • Develop predictive or forward-looking analyses (e.g., time-to-fill forecasts, pipeline conversion estimates) 
  • Identify patterns and trends in recruiting data using AI-assisted methods 
  • Explore opportunities to use AI to improve sourcing strategies, job descriptions, and candidate engagement 
  • Generate automated or semi-automated summaries of key insights for stakeholders 

Stakeholder Collaboration 

  • Partner with TA leadership to understand reporting needs and priorities 
  • Present findings and insights to stakeholders in a clear and compelling way 
  • Incorporate feedback to continuously improve reporting and dashboards

About Progyny:   

Progyny (Nasdaq: PGNY) is a global leader in women’s health and family building solutions, trusted by the nation’s leading employers, health plans and benefit purchasers. We envision a world where everyone can realize dreams of family and ideal health. Our outcomes prove that comprehensive, inclusive and intentionally designed solutions simultaneously benefit employers, patients and physicians. 

Our benefits solution empowers patients with concierge support, coaching, education, and digital tools; provides access to a premier network of fertility and women's health specialists who use the latest science and technologies; drives optimal clinical outcomes; and reduces healthcare costs.  

Our mission is to empower healthier, supported journeys through transformative fertility, family building and women’s health benefits.
